What skills and experience we're looking for
We are seeking to appoint an inspirational and highly motivated Specialist Provision & Inclusion Lead to lead our specialist provision, The LINK, and play a key role within our wider SEND and Inclusion team as keyworker for students who are cared for by the local authority.
This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ced practitioner and leader to combine strong operational leadership with strategic influence. You will ensure that students accessing The LINK are fully supported to engage in mainstream learning and achieve positive academic, social and emotional outcomes.
In addition, you will play a lead role in supporting students who are cared for by the local authority, acting as a consistent keyworker and advocate to ensure their needs are fully understood and met. You will take responsibility for coordinating provision, leading on PEP processes and working closely with families, social care, the Virtual School and other professionals to secure strong educational progress, engagement and long-term outcomes for these vulnerable young people.
Working in close partnership with the SENCo and wider SEND Leadership, you will contribute to the ongoing development of inclusive practice across the school. You will line manage an Autism Practitioner, ensuring high-quality provision, effective interventions and a clear focus on impact for all learners within the provision.
The successful candidate will demonstrate exceptional interpersonal skills, high emotional intelligence and a strong commitment to inclusion. They will be confident leading others, building relationships and maintaining consistently high expectations for students, particularly those with SEND and additional vulnerabilities.
